Latest Patents

His latest patents reflect his innovative approach. The first, titled "Fluid Delivery Alignment System," features a device designed for delivering fluid to the ocular surface. This invention incorporates a self-alignment mechanism, allowing precise fluid delivery to the target area on a user’s eye. The device includes a fluid package with a reservoir and apertures, alongside an actuator configured to eject fluid efficiently. Additionally, the kit includes methods for utilizing these devices in various fluid delivery scenarios.

The second patent, "Piezoelectric Fluid Dispenser," describes a fluid delivery mechanism employing a piezoelectric actuator connected to a preloaded ampoule containing the fluid. This ampoule is crafted from thin-walled thermoplastic material with strategically positioned apertures. The piezoelectric actuator’s oscillations create acoustic pressure cycles in the fluid, enabling the controlled ejection of droplets or streams through the ampoule's walls.
